Bandits Burn 11 Houses in Benue Village, Security Forces Repel Attack

In Benue State, bandits invaded Anwas Village in the Kwande Local Government Area, burning down 11 houses and causing injuries to several residents. The State Command spokesperson, DSP Udem Edet, confirmed the attack and stated that security forces repelled the bandits without any casualties.

This attack comes amidst ongoing security challenges in the region, with previous incidents leading to the deaths of six people, including a former councillor, Lawrence Akerigb. The bandits' repeated attacks in Benue State, particularly in Kwande LGA, have raised significant security concerns.

The assault on Anwas Village occurred on a Friday, following a similar attack on Tuesday that resulted in six deaths. The former councillor lamented the continuous violence in the area, highlighting previous incidents where 28 people were killed on Christmas Day in 2024 and a total of 76 deaths over the past two years in various communities within the local government.
